Roof damage inspection services involve a thorough assessment of a property's roof to identify existing issues and potential vulnerabilities. These inspections typically include a visual examination of the roof's surface, flashing, gutters, and other key components, often supplemented by the use of specialized tools or equipment. The goal is to detect signs of damage such as missing or broken shingles, leaks, mold growth, and structural weaknesses that may not be immediately visible from the ground. Conducting regular inspections can help property owners proactively address problems before they escalate into more serious and costly repairs.

The primary purpose of roof damage inspections is to help property owners solve problems related to leaks, water intrusion, and structural deterioration. By identifying issues early, inspections can prevent further damage to the interior of the building, including ceilings, walls, and insulation. They also assist in assessing whether a roof is nearing the end of its lifespan or if repairs are necessary to extend its durability. For properties with existing damage, these inspections provide valuable information to guide effective repair or replacement decisions, ultimately helping to maintain the property's safety and value.

Inspection Costs - The price for a roof damage inspection typically ranges from $150 to $400, depending on the size and complexity of the roof. Larger or more complex roofs may cost more, with some inspections reaching up to $500. Local pros can provide detailed quotes based on specific needs.

Visual Assessment Fees - Visual assessments usually cost between $100 and $300. This includes a thorough visual check for visible damage, leaks, and wear, with costs varying by property size and inspection scope. Additional services may incur extra charges.

Comprehensive Inspection Expenses - A detailed, comprehensive roof inspection can range from $200 to $600. These inspections often include drone or aerial assessments and detailed reporting, with prices influenced by roof height and accessibility.

Additional Cost Factors - Extra costs may apply for services like thermal imaging or detailed damage reports, which can add $100 to $300 to the overall price. Costs vary based on the extent of inspection required and specific property conditions.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

How can I tell if my roof has damage? Signs of roof damage include missing or broken shingles, water stains on ceilings or walls, and visible wear or sagging on the roof surface. A professional inspection can help identify issues that may not be immediately visible.

What should I do if I suspect roof damage? If roof damage is suspected, it is recommended to contact local roofing professionals for an inspection. They can assess the extent of the damage and advise on necessary repairs or maintenance.

How often should roof inspections be performed? Regular roof inspections are typically recommended at least once a year and after severe weather events to ensure the roof remains in good condition.

Can roof damage lead to other issues? Yes, untreated roof damage can lead to leaks, mold growth, and structural deterioration, which may result in more extensive and costly repairs.

What types of damage can roof inspections identify? Roof inspections can identify a range of issues including missing shingles, leaks, damaged flashing, and signs of wear that could compromise the roof’s integrity.
